Jessica Simpson couldn't help but brag about her husband Eric Johnson as she took to Instagram to wish him a happy birthday this week. The singer posted a black and white snapshot of her other half, who celebrated his 36th birthday on 15 September, writing alongside: "My husband is hotter than yours! Happy birthday Eric Maxwell Johnson! You forever make me lust."Jessica and Eric, who are parents to Maxwell Drew, three, and two-year-old son Ace, started dating in May 2010 and announced their engagement in November of that same year. In July 2014, they tied the knot in front of family and friends at San Ysidro Ranch in California.

In September, 35-year-old Jessica spoke to Matt Lauer about her relationship with Eric. "I just think we're a little bit more addicted to each other," she said of married life. "I just think there is a level of love that has reached the highest of high. "The star, who was previously married to Nick Lachey from 2002 until 2005, added: "Eric and I have both been married before, so we took our time finding the right person. When we found each other, we knew it had to be forever. "Just last week, Jessica opened up about her first marriage, describing it as her "biggest money mistake". It has since been reported that she was referring to the fact she had to pay Nick $12million in their divorce, because she didn't sign a pre-nuptial agreement before their wedding.
